7.26 AnalogSignalType

The AnalogSignalType provides ObjectType to add variables and ZeroPointAdjustment Method. It is formally defined in Table 150.

Table 150 – AnalogSignalType definition
Attribute Value
BrowseNameAnalogSignalType
IsAbstractFalse
References NodeClass BrowseName DataType TypeDefinition Other
Subtype of SignalType defined in 7.23, i.e. inheriting the InstanceDeclarations of that Node
0:HasComponentMethodZeroPointAdjustmentDefined in 9.2O
0:HasComponentVariableAnalogSignal0:Number{Any}AnalogSignalVariableTypeM
0:HasComponentObject<SignalCalibrationIdentifier>0:BaseObjectTypeOP
0:HasComponentObjectSignalConditionSet0:BaseObjectTypeO
Conformance Units
PA-DIM Analog Signal
PA-DIM ZeroPointAdjustment method
PA-DIM ICalibration
PA-DIM ICalibration CalibrationTimestamp
PA-DIM ICalibration TypeOfCalibration
PA-DIM ICalibration CalibrationPointSet
PA-DIM Signal Condition Set

ZeroPointAdjustment: ABN614#002 defines property that initiates when set the TRUE (ON) state a procedure, which maybe automatic, to define or set the value zero of the output. Remark: properties can be variables or methods according to IEC 61987 CDD.

AnalogSignal provides the measured or readback process value. The unit of this value is provided by the EngineeringUnits property.

<SignalCalibrationIdentifier> is a container object for the calibration parameters of the signal. It has an interface reference to ICalibrationType in order to add general calibration variables. Since it is a placeholder, an instance of AnalogSignalType can have several calibration objects.

SignalConditionSet is a container object for the condition parameters of the signal.

The components of AnalogSignalType have additional references which are defined in Table 151.

Table 151 – AnalogSignalType additional References
SourceBrowsePath Reference Type Is Forward TargetBrowsePath
0:HasDictionaryEntryTrue 3:0112/2///61987#ABA968#004
<SignalCalibrationIdentifier>0:HasInterfaceTrueICalibrationType
ZeroPointAdjustment0:HasDictionaryEntryTrue 3:0112/2///61987#ABN614#002

The components of AnalogSignalType have additional subcomponents which are defined in Table 152.

Table 152 – AnalogSignalType additional subcomponents
BrowsePath References NodeClass BrowseName DataType TypeDefinition Others
Applied from ICalibrationType
<SignalCalibrationIdentifier>0:HasPropertyVariableCalibrationTimestamp0:DateTime0:PropertyTypeO
<SignalCalibrationIdentifier>0:HasComponentVariableTypeOfCalibration0:UInt320:MultiStateDictionaryEntryDiscreteTypeO
<SignalCalibrationIdentifier>0:HasComponentObjectCalibrationPointSetCalibrationPointSetTypeO

The child Nodes of the AnalogSignalType have additional Attribute values defined in Table 153.

Table 153 – AnalogSignalType Attribute values for child Nodes
BrowsePath Value Attribute
1/1/1601 12:00:00 AM
0
ns=3;s=0112/2///61987#ABP732#001
adjustment